A brand new musical will open at Sydney’s Parade theatre this week…the brainchild of one of Sydney’s Jewish showbiz personalities.

“Every Single Saturday” was conceived, written and directed by Joanna Weinberg and takes a musical look at the antics of soccer parents. The play also stars well-known local identity, Geoff Sirmai and is choreographed by Daniella Lacob.

Weinberg, a mother of two, featured in 18 TV series in her native Cape Town before emigrating to Australia in 1996…spending her early years as a budding professional busking in the South African city’s streets.

Cabaret became one of Weinberg’s strong points and she wrote the words and music for her long featuring one-woman show “The Piano Diaries”.

Every Single Saturday started its life as a well-received short play which Weinberg has expanded into a full-blown musical.  Read more about the show here…and for booking details.
